Context
In this hadith, the Prophet Muhammad ﷺ reflects on how Allah protects him from the insults of the Quraish. He points out that while they insult 'Mudhammam', they are actually referring to him, Muhammad. This illustrates the power of Allah in diverting negativity and highlights the importance of maintaining a positive identity.
